In an art studio in the Gaza Strip, children meet rabbits, dogs, hedgehogs and birds as part of a psychological support session. "The natural presence of animals and birds with their vibrant colours, absorbs negative energy," says project leader Rashid Anbar. "Interacting with them fosters an atmosphere of happiness and positive energy". Anbar rescued abandoned animals from the streets of Gaza and gave them a new purpose supporting children in the area.
